    Wanted to buy passenger exhaust manifold

    Bolt it to a loose head and weld it. There is an 'art' to welding cast iron so it won't crack adjacent to the weld, so be sure the guy doing it knows what he's doing. Pre-heating the part prior to welding is an important step in the process. That was my plan for the crack if it had gotten bad...

    Wanted : Left door panel 93ty

    Interior door panels for the 93 Ty are identicle to 93 and 94 Jimmy SLT (Leather Interior Trim) both 2-door and 4-door. The color may be tough, many SLTs were tan and lt grey. Not charcoal.

    Setting pinion angle question

    The angles that are measured and that matter are at the two u-joints. What angle the drive shaft is to any other reference such as the crankshaft, frame, floor pan, ground, etc is irrelevant. Up to 1 degree difference is allowable. Not 3. If I am interpreting your measurements correctly, you...

    1992 Typhoon

    Technically, all SyTy are 4-wheel ABS. The 91 and 92 are "4- input". They have speed sensors on each wheel. The 93 is "3-input". The 93 uses the VSS signal for the rear wheel speed signal. Two front sensors, and VSS for the rear. All 3 systems are "3-channel" ABS. The module can control each...
